About this home

Pleasanton schools! Discover timeless elegance in Pleasanton’s exclusive gated Ruby Hill community! This exquisite home effortlessly blends sophistication and comfort with a huge gourmet kitchen featuring stainless steel appliances, a large center island, and a bright dining nook that bathes the kitchen and family room in tons of natural light. A formal dining room provides the perfect setting for hosting elegant gatherings, while a downstairs bed & full bath retreat offers flexible space for guests or a private office. The 3-car garage ensures ample storage and convenience. Nestled on an massive 15,194 sq ft court lot, the beautifully landscaped yard is a true standout, offering multiple patios, a sport court, lush lawns, and raised garden beds. With abundant space for a future ADU or pool, the possibilities for outdoor luxury are endless. Ruby Hill residents enjoy world-class amenities, including a pool, clubhouse, tennis and basketball courts, and outdoor gathering spaces. Conveniently located near downtown Pleasanton, Livermore Valley wine country, outdoor recreation, and with easy Hwy 84 access, this home delivers an unmatched lifestyle combining elegance, recreation, and convenience.
